Monarto Safari Resort:
Nestled in the heart of South Australia's Murraylands, Monarto Safari Resort is more than just a hotel: it's an opportunity for you to experience the raw beauty of nature, wild African animals and a luxurious day spa. Located next to Monarto Safari Park, the largest open air safari experience outside of Africa, the property features a modern, design-led hotel offering nature-based serenity and unique views of the safari park's native and African wildlife. This hotel includes 78 guest rooms and suites, two swimming pools with a pool bar & cafe, conference facilities, restaurant and bar. A luxurious onsite day spa will further enhance the experience and include a vitality pool, sauna and cold plunge pool. DAY 5 - MONARTO SAFARI RESORT
Today is yours to explore Monarto Safari Park via the guided Zu-Loop bus experience, or a combination of the Zu-Loop bus and walking. Monarto is the largest open range safari experience in the world outside of Africa and spans more than 1,500 hectares and is home to more than 50 species of exotic and native mammals, birds and reptiles. You can hop on and off the bus at the wildlife viewing platforms and spend time observing your favourite animal species, including Giraffes, Elephants, Lions, Cheetahs, Rhinos, Chimpanzees, and more. Additionally, you can enhance your visit by attending Daily Keeper Presentations and booking a range of intimate behind the scenes animal experiences. (B)
